The World Cup 2023 kick-started this Thursday at the iconic, gigantic Narendra Modi Stadium in Ahmedabad. Defending champions England suffered a shockingly massive defeat by 9…
The World Cup 2023 kick-started this Thursday at the iconic, gigantic Narendra Modi Stadium in Ahmedabad. Defending champions England suffered a shockingly massive defeat by 9…
The schedule for the World Cup 2023 is finally out. The tournament will be the 13th edition of the ODI World Cup. It will be the…